Handover note — Crumbwheel order cutoffs.

Welcome aboard. The bakery cutoff rule in Crumbwheel closes same-day orders at 14:00 local to each storefront, not UTC — this has bitten us twice. Holiday overrides live in the calendar service and take precedence silently, so always check there first when a cutoff looks wrong. To unlock the calendar service's admin console after a restart, enter the recovery passphrase below.

vault phrase of bagap-bahaf = silion-pelox-sorox-casdor-quenwyn-fraax-eliox-praael-kelion-quenvan-kasox-rusael-norius-belvan

Hey, welcome aboard! Quick handover on the Textlinter encoding sniffer for Dovebright uploads. It guesses charset from BOM first, then falls back to the Quillscan heuristic — don't trust it for short files under 200 bytes, it loves guessing Latin-1 wrongly. Tests live in sniffer_spec; run them before touching the fallback table. Anything weird with Shift-JIS files, loop in the module owner named below.

named custodian: Brivan Eliath Quenox Frador

## Runbook: Account Recovery After Websocket Reconnect Bug

New team members: the Pinebranch client has a known bug where rapid websocket reconnects can invalidate a user's session token mid-handshake, locking the account. First confirm the lockout in the session ledger, then expire all stale tokens before attempting recovery — skipping this re-triggers the bug. To authorize the recovery flow in the Hollowgate admin tool, enter the recovery passphrase below.

recovery phrase for kahof-hawif: holok-julvan-eliax-ulaath-briath

Leadership Review Briefing — Customer Concentration Risk

For the finance team: revenue dependence on Abelhart Group has reached 38% of the Norwick division's total, up from 29% last year. Contract renewal falls in Q2, and pricing pressure is expected. Mitigation options are being modelled. The board's preferred direction, which must remain restricted, is noted below.

internal memo for fajog-yagaf: Gross margin on Ulaael came in at 20 percent against a plan of 10 percent. Only 9 of the 80 pilot accounts renewed Ulaael, so a churn review is set for July 1.